Dogmatism and belief formation: Output interference in the processing of supporting and contradictory cognitions

摘要
The role of reason generation in dogmatic thinking was examined by means of cognitive response analysis. In Experiment 1, dogmatism was associated with greater confidence in judgments as a result of postjudgment generation of more supporting and less contradictory evidence. Experiment 2 produced similar results for confidence judgments with prejudgment reason generation, except that no difference in supporting evidence was found as a function of dogmatism. Experiment 3 showed that dogmatism was associated with greater output interference in reason generation, leading to greater primacy effects in likelihood judgments. A delay between generation of reasons reduced output interference effects, but only for those low in dogmatism who showed a recency effect. The results were interpreted in terms of cognitive mechanisms in dogmatic thinking after artifactual and motivation explanations had been ruled out.
